I use a Wraith for distance. I have 3 in my bag right now and am receiving more (thank you Discaroo!!!). I can control them, they have just enough snap and good speed. They work really well for myself. I can get more distance with a Boss or a Force (I have two first-run ESPs), but I can't control them. My course doesn't have many open holes, so I prefer to throw something I can control. Are you throwing backhand or side-arm?
